Top 5 Common Dishwasher Problems and DIY Repair Tips


1. Unusual Noises

One of the first signs that something may be wrong with your dishwasher is unusual noises during operation. While dishwashers, especially modern models like Bosch, are designed to operate quietly, loud grinding or banging sounds may indicate a mechanical issue.

DIY Fix:

  • Inspect the spray arms: Sometimes, a dish or utensil might be blocking the spray arms from rotating properly. Make sure nothing is obstructing their movement.
  • Check for debris in the pump area: Small bits of food or other debris can get stuck in the pump, causing it to make noise. Removing these can often solve the problem.

When to Call a Pro:

  • If the noise persists even after cleaning and checking for obstructions, it could indicate a worn-out motor or pump, which requires professional attention from Melbourne Dishwasher Repairs.

2. Drainage Problems

If you notice standing water at the bottom of your dishwasher after a cycle, you’re likely dealing with a drainage issue. Whirlpool dishwashers, known for their efficient drainage systems, can still experience clogs due to food particles, grease, or even small pieces of debris.

DIY Fix:

  • Clean the filter: Regularly cleaning the dishwasher filter can prevent clogs. Simply remove the filter and rinse it under warm water to clear away debris.
  • Inspect the drain hose: Make sure the drain hose isn’t kinked or blocked. You can also run a drain cleaner through the hose if there’s a clog.

When to Call a Pro:

  • If cleaning the filter and inspecting the drain hose doesn’t solve the problem, there could be a deeper issue with the drain pump or motor. Contact Melbourne Dishwasher Repairs to address this more complex problem.

3. Dishes Aren’t Coming Out Clean

It’s frustrating when your dishwasher runs a full cycle but your dishes still come out dirty. This issue could be caused by several factors, such as clogged spray arms, improper loading, or even low water temperature.

DIY Fix:

  • Check the spray arms: Make sure the spray arms are spinning freely and that the holes are not clogged. You can use a toothpick or small brush to clear any debris.
  • Use the right detergent: Using too little or the wrong type of detergent can result in unclean dishes. Make sure you’re using a high-quality detergent that’s compatible with your machine.
  • Check the water temperature: Ensure your water heater is set to at least 120°F (49°C) to ensure optimal cleaning.

When to Call a Pro:

  • If these DIY fixes don’t improve the cleanliness of your dishes, there could be an issue with the water inlet valve or detergent dispenser, both of which require professional repair from Melbourne Dishwasher Repairs.

4. Door Latch Problems

A dishwasher that won’t start could be due to a faulty door latch. This is a common issue in both Bosch and Whirlpool dishwashers, where the latch mechanism or door seals may wear out over time, preventing the machine from running a cycle.

DIY Fix:

  • Inspect the latch: If the latch is loose or misaligned, you can often tighten it yourself with a screwdriver. Make sure the door is closing properly and there’s nothing obstructing it.
  • Check the door seals: Worn-out seals can also prevent the door from closing fully. Inspect the rubber seals around the door for any signs of wear and replace them if necessary.

When to Call a Pro:

  • If the latch or door mechanism is broken, or the door continues to have trouble sealing properly, call Melbourne Dishwasher Repairs for a full inspection and replacement of parts.

5. Leaks

Dishwasher leaks can lead to water damage in your kitchen, so it’s important to address them quickly. Leaks are often caused by worn-out door seals, loose connections, or a cracked water hose.

DIY Fix:

  • Inspect the door seals: Check for cracks or gaps in the door seals and replace them if necessary. This is a common cause of leaks, especially in older machines.
  • Tighten hose connections: Sometimes leaks are the result of loose hose connections. Tightening them with a wrench can stop the leak.

When to Call a Pro:

  • If the leak persists after checking the seals and connections, it could be a more serious issue like a cracked pump or tub. In such cases, it’s best to call Melbourne Dishwasher Repairs to prevent further damage.
